    This game desperately needs someone who can COMMUNICATE like Ghostcrawler.

    Love him or hate him, he gave long explanations of why the developers were taking WOW in the directions they did, the reasons they did 'X' and not 'Y', and engaged in long and often contentious conversations with players.

    True, he got trolled a lot but he was an adult, he dealt with it. WOW is a lot poorer now he's gone, the engagement between Blizzard and the players is palpably less.

    Of course, even at the reduced company/player interaction WOW has now .. or for that matter, Rift to name another .. it's still vastly more than we get here.
